There's no place like home for Greenbrier, who bounced back after a tough loss on the road last Thursday. They came out on top against the White House Blue Devils by a score of 5-3 on Monday. The high-flying offensive performance was a huge turnaround for Greenbrier considering their one-goal performance the match before.
They hit White House with a four-pronged attack, as the team got scores from
Dany Retana (2),
Wally Martinez,
Melvis Lopez, and
Ezekial McClelland.
Greenbrier's win bumped their record up to 2-4. As for White House,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 1-6.
Greenbrier will head out on the road to square off against Portland at 7:00 p.m. on Thursday. Portland is strutting in with some offensive muscle, as they've averaged 3.1 goals per game this season. As for White House,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Hendersonville at 7:00 p.m. on Thursday.
